Cortex (Grey matter) - functional areas - motor areas

3 important questions on Cortex (Grey matter) - functional areas - motor areas


In the motor areas of the cerebral cortex where is the Primary (somatic) motor cortex located and what is the name of the large neurons that it is made up of?

Located in the precentral gyrus of the frontal lobe
Large neurons are called pyramidal cells.

What is the Premotor Cortex located anterior to? What does this motor area control? And if damaged what kind of movement will you not be able to do?

anterior to primary motor cortex
Controls learned, repetitive, or patterned motor skills (eg. playing a musical instrument or typing).
Cannot coordinate simultaneous or sequential actions (skilled motor activities) because planning of movements is broken down

Where is the motor area of the cerebral cortex front eye field located, and what does it control?

Located anterior to the premotor cortex and superior to Broca’s area.
Controls voluntary eye movement.
